Discover the key figures for PDO and PGI dairy products in 2022

With 51 PDOs and 11 PGIs, dairy products represent an important part of agri-food production under official signs of origin and quality. To give you a better grasp of the economics of this sector, INAO and the Conseil National des Appellations d'Origine Laitières (CNAOL) have compiled the key information for 2022 in a comprehensive and educational publication.

A general meeting under the sign of sustainability

This publication was distributed at the CNAOL annual general meeting, held in Laguiole on Friday, September 29, 2023. The theme of this event was the sustainability of dairy PDOs. In a spirit of exchange between the sectors, M. Christian PALY, President of INAO's Comité national des Appellations d'origine relatives aux vins et aux boissons alcoolisées, et des boissons spiritueuses, took part in a round-table discussion to present the tools deployed in viticulture, including the innovation evaluation system.

INAO and economic monitoring of SIQO

INAO collects and analyzes economic data on SIQO products. The Institute makes the most of this information through various media: key figures, regional mementos, industry data...

These documents are drawn up using data collected during the annual statistical survey of defense and management bodies (producers' associations, professional federations of products under official signs) and in partnership with other public players (FranceAgriMer, INRAE, AGRESTE, the Regional Directorates of Agriculture, Agri-Food and Forestry, Agence Bio, regional Chambers of Agriculture, etc.).
